Choo Mi-ae, the leader of South Korea's ruling Democratic Party, will meet Chinese leader Xi Jinping for talks during her trip to Beijing this week, her aide said Wednesday.
The meeting is slated to take place on the sidelines of an international conference of political parties in the Chinese capital Friday, amid heightened tensions sparked by North Korea's long-range ballistic missile launch on Wednesday.
Choo embarks on her four-day visit to China on Thursday to attend the conference, titled the "Communist Party of China in Dialogue with World Political Parties High-level Meeting," and meet Beijing officials and South Korean residents there.
